Transaction 59d83cbeb4b3d759987c482aab9733501bedf8c1b91fcb984cbecdd517e1f3a4
1 Input
1 Output
-
59d83cbeb4b3d759987c482aab9733501bedf8c1b91fcb984cbecdd517e1f3a4:0
- value
- 89222
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ec02f67f1a04e31bb4057bf89a7628c129695c3
- address
- bc1qpmqz7el35p8rrw6q27lcnfmz3sffd9wrrhuzsa